Output 95578428ea0469fe1b3a2b23bcab007124bf0731b70f46405f59b4e51c7b892a:0

value
964559
script pubkey
OP_0 OP_PUSHBYTES_32 44817517323ad168e2b25bb3de553ec31d03014ba981571ce5e9a791bae328e8
address
bc1qgjqh29ej8tgk3c4jtweau4f7cvwsxq2t4xq4w889axnerwhr9r5qc20fze
transaction
95578428ea0469fe1b3a2b23bcab007124bf0731b70f46405f59b4e51c7b892a
spent
true